Omar Vizquel
Share tweet me
Birthdate: 4/24/1967
Height / Weight: 5' 9" / 165 lbs.
Place of Birth: Caracas, , Venezuela
Bats / Throws: B / R

News of the Day – November 15 2004 ‘To get somebody of Omar’s caliber is certainly a godsend,’ San Francisco GM Brian Sabean said after signing the 37 year old free agent Omar Vizquel to a 3-year $12.25 million pact.  Sabean went on to declare, ‘I think if you watch him play, he has a passion for the game and is in great shape.’  The switch hitting, Venezuelan born Omar Vizquel was the Mariners starting shortstop on Opening Day 1989 as a 22 year old rookie.  After being traded to Cleveland in the mid-‘90s and helping the Indians win division titles during the late 1990s, Vizquel began to receive recognition as one of the best fielding shortstops in baseball history.

Batting Statistics
Year Team G AB R H 2B 3B HR RBI BB SO SB CS IBB HBP SH SF AVG OBP SLG
1989 SEA (AL) 143 387 45 85 7 3 1 20 28 40 1 4 0 1 13 2 .220 .273 SLG
1990 SEA (AL) 81 255 19 63 3 2 2 18 18 22 4 1 0 0 10 2 .247 .295 SLG
1991 SEA (AL) 142 426 42 98 16 4 1 41 45 37 7 2 0 0 8 3 .230 .302 SLG
1992 SEA (AL) 136 483 49 142 20 4 0 21 32 38 15 13 0 2 9 1 .294 .340 SLG
1993 SEA (AL) 158 560 68 143 14 2 2 31 50 71 12 14 2 4 13 3 .255 .319 SLG
1994 CLE (AL) 69 286 39 78 10 1 1 33 23 23 13 4 0 0 11 2 .273 .325 SLG
1995 CLE (AL) 136 542 87 144 28 0 6 56 59 59 29 11 0 1 10 10 .266 .333 SLG
1996 CLE (AL) 151 542 98 161 36 1 9 64 56 42 35 9 0 4 12 9 .297 .362 SLG
1997 CLE (AL) 153 565 89 158 23 6 5 49 57 58 43 12 1 2 16 2 .280 .347 SLG
1998 CLE (AL) 151 576 86 166 30 6 2 50 62 64 37 12 1 4 12 6 .288 .358 SLG
1999 CLE (AL) 144 574 112 191 36 4 5 66 65 50 42 9 0 1 17 7 .333 .397 SLG
2000 CLE (AL) 156 613 101 176 27 3 7 66 87 72 22 10 0 5 7 5 .287 .377 SLG
2001 CLE (AL) 155 611 84 156 26 8 2 50 61 72 13 9 0 2 15 4 .255 .323 SLG
2002 CLE (AL) 151 582 85 160 31 5 14 72 56 64 18 10 3 8 7 10 .275 .341 SLG
2003 CLE (AL) 64 250 43 61 13 2 2 19 29 20 8 3 0 0 5 1 .244 .321 SLG
2004 CLE (AL) 148 567 82 165 28 3 7 59 57 62 19 6 0 1 20 6 .291 .353 SLG
2005 SFG (NL) 152 568 66 154 28 4 3 45 56 58 24 10 0 5 20 2 .271 .341 SLG
2006 SFG (NL) 153 579 88 171 22 10 4 58 56 51 24 7 3 6 13 5 .295 .361 SLG
18 years   2443 8966 1283 2472 398 68 73 818 897 903 366 146 10 46 218 80 .276 .342 .SLG
